RAFAEL PICKS HIS SIX-A-SIDE TEAM

Submitted on Thu, 09/09/2021 - 09:44

Former Manchester United right-back Rafael da Silva has picked his six-a-side team in an exclusive interview with MUTV Group Chat as he found it hard to settle on his goalkeeper. Rafael da Silva had two options namely Edwin Van Der Sar and David De Gea.

Rafael da Silva changed his answer once on the goalkeeper for his team before he finally made the decision to start retired Dutch national team shot stopper Edwin Van Der Sar in goal. Van Der Sar is the current CEO (Chief Executive Officer) at Dutch Eredivisie side Ajax Amsterdam.

For the team in front of Van Der Sar, Rafael da Silva went for the likes of Ryan Giggs, Antonio Valencia, Cristiano Ronaldo, Rio Ferdinand and Wayne Rooney.

England international Ferdinand was the only defensive-minded player in the Manchester United six-a-side team selected by Rafael da Silva.

Since leaving Manchester United during the Louis Van Gaal era, Rafael has featured for both Lyon in the French Ligue 1 and Turkish Super League team Istanbul Basaksehir but his love for the Red Devils remains intact. Rafael da Silva is a cult hero amongst the supporters of Manchester United.

Rafael joined the Red Devils alongside his twin brother, Fabio in 2007 and they had to wait for several months before the chance to play opened for the two Brazilian players.

Brazilian defender Rafael turned out for Manchester United 170 times. He scored five goals in all competitions during his time at the Theatre of Dreams. During his time in Manchester, Rafael won three Premier League titles including the 20th record-breaking league title at the end of the 2012/13 campaign.

The record-breaking feat came during the final season under Sir Alex Ferguson at Manchester United. Rafael lasted one more season at the club before he left to sign from French Ligue 1 club.
